Ok, now I'm hunting for artillery. I've spent days searching around and can't find any 1:18 scale US artillery and its driving me nuts. Anyone know of any 1:18 arty? Even if its PTE or lesser quality, as long as it looks like US artillery. make me mad that 21c has german but not allied 1:18 artillery. Thanks
pte make a howitzer, gi joe had a 75mm howitzer (try ebay)in 3 3/4" scale and there is an out of scale mim 23 for gijoe called the mms, the mobile missile system. lanard had a katyusha launcher of sorts (more like the actual pod from a bm 21, but on a stand) and there are various gi joe and 120mm scale mortars (verlinden for example) around.. there is also the towed maxson mount from 21st century toys...and bbi have support weapons sets (mk19..not vietnam vintage, stingers and such like) and pte has LAWs..
